DTC P0720:00 [TCM (ET6A-EL, ET6AX-EL) (E)]

DTC P0720:00 [TCM (ET6A-EL, ET6AX-EL) (E)]


 id0502q98177r2

Outline

System malfunction location

Output shaft speed sensor range/performance problem

Detection condition
•  Under the following conditions, there is no correlation between the vehicle speed signal from the DSC HU/CM (without Mazda M Hybrid)/electronically controlled brake unit (with Mazda M Hybrid) and the output shaft speed sensor.
―  Engine is running.
―  The vehicle is driven at the specified speed or more.
―  Vehicle speed signal related DTC is not recorded.
―  There is no correlation between vehicle speed signal from DSC HU/CM (without Mazda M Hybrid)/electronically controlled brake unit (with Mazda M Hybrid) and turbine/input shaft speed sensor signal.
―  DTC P0721:00 and P0722:00 are not recorded.
Fail-safe
•  Inhibits learning control.
•  Inhibits manual mode.
•  Inhibits neutral idle control.
•  Inhibits i-stop control.
•  Inhibits AAS.
Possible cause
•  Output shaft speed sensor malfunction

Diagnostic Procedure

Step

Inspection

Results

Action

1
VERIFY DSC HU/CM (WITHOUT Mazda M Hybrid)/ELECTRONICALLY CONTROLLED BRAKE UNIT (WITH Mazda M Hybrid) DTC
•  Perform the DSC HU/CM (without Mazda M Hybrid)/electronically controlled brake unit (with Mazda M Hybrid) DTC inspection using the M-MDS.
•  Are any DTCs present?
Yes
Go to the applicable DTC inspection.
No
Go to the next step.
2
VERIFY INSTRUMENT CLUSTER REPAIR HISTORY
•  Does the instrument cluster have a record of replacement?
Yes
Perform the instrument cluster configuration using the M-MDS.
Go to repair completion verification.
No
Go to the next step.
3
VERIFY A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ION REPAIR HISTORY
•  Does the automatic transmission (with control valve body) have a record of replacement?
Yes
Perform the TCM configuration using the M-MDS.
Go to repair completion verification.
No
Go to the next step.
4
RECORD VEHICLE STATUS WHEN DTC WAS DETECTED TO UTILIZE WITH REPEATABILITY VERIFICATION
•  Record the freeze frame data/snapshot data.
Note
•  Recording can be facilitated using the screen capture of the PC function.
Go to the next step.
5
VERIFY RELATED REPAIR INFORMATION OR SERVICE INFORMATION AVAILABILITY
•  Verify related Service Bulletins, on-line repair information, or Service Information availability.
•  Is any related information available?
Yes
Perform repair or diagnosis according to the available information.
•  If the vehicle is not repaired, replace the control valve body.
Go to repair completion verification
No
Replace the control valve body, then go to repair completion verification.
Repair completion verification
VERIFY DTC TROUBLESHOOTING COMPLETED
•  Clear the DTC using the M-MDS.
•  Perform the following procedure to ensure that the DTC has been resolved:
1.  Drive the vehicle for 1 s or more under the following condition:
•  Vehicle speed: 30 km/h {19 mph} or more
•  Perform the DTC inspection using the M-MDS.
•  Are any DTCs present?
Yes
Repair the malfunctioning location according to the applicable DTC troubleshooting.
No
DTC troubleshooting completed.
